    Alright, let's talk strategy for finding houses for sale in Georgetown MA. The real estate market, especially in desirable New England towns like Georgetown, can be competitive. Understanding this market is key to making a successful purchase. First things first, get your finances in order. Talk to a mortgage lender before you start seriously looking. Getting pre-approved for a mortgage will give you a clear picture of your budget and make your offer much stronger when you find the right place. Sellers love knowing you're a serious, qualified buyer. Next, partner with a knowledgeable local real estate agent. An agent who specializes in Georgetown and the surrounding areas will have invaluable insights into market trends, upcoming listings, and neighborhoods you might not have discovered on your own. They can also guide you through the offer process, negotiations, and closing. Be prepared for the possibility of multiple offers, especially on well-priced and attractive properties. This means you need to be decisive and ready to act when you find a home you love. It's also important to be realistic about pricing. While Georgetown offers tremendous value, prices reflect the desirability of the town. Research recent sales in the areas you're interested in to get a feel for fair market value. When you find houses for sale in Georgetown MA that capture your interest, be sure to attend open houses and schedule private showings promptly. Take your time to thoroughly inspect each property, and don't hesitate to ask your agent lots of questions. Consider hiring a professional home inspector once your offer is accepted to uncover any potential issues before you commit. Navigating the market requires patience, preparation, and a bit of savvy.     So, you're actively looking for houses for sale in Georgetown MA, and you want to make sure your search is as smooth and successful as possible. Here are some tried-and-true tips to keep in mind. First off, define your must-haves. Before you even start browsing listings, sit down and make a list of your absolute non-negotiables. How many bedrooms do you need? What about bathrooms? Is a large yard essential? Do you need a home office space? Prioritizing these needs will help you filter through listings effectively and prevent you from wasting time on properties that just won't work. On the flip side, also consider your 'nice-to-haves' – things that would be great but aren't deal-breakers. Secondly, be realistic about your budget. We touched on pre-approval earlier, but it's worth repeating. Know your absolute maximum spending limit and stick to it. Factor in not just the mortgage payment but also property taxes, insurance, potential HOA fees, and the costs of moving and setting up your new home. Thirdly, visit properties at different times of day. A house might seem perfect during a sunny afternoon open house, but what's it like during rush hour? Is the street noisy? How's the natural light in the morning? Visiting at different times can give you a more complete picture of the property and its surroundings. Fourth, don't fall too in love too quickly. It's easy to get emotionally attached to a house, but try to maintain objectivity. Look beyond the staging and the paint color. Consider the layout, the structure, and the potential for future needs. Always do your due diligence with inspections. Finally, trust your gut. If something feels off about a property or a neighborhood, pay attention to that feeling. Ultimately, you want to find a home where you feel comfortable, safe, and happy.
